Output 6c691d1e66d59f532d92f5d6e4000f14a004c004dec745cc2be108d11cc4eed1:1

value
986654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 068520449a1770ac68ca0f3e4242ac668cc642b0 OP_EQUAL
address
32HVTTKcdjAGj8vTw696yKNYqNuW3mLUsJ
transaction
6c691d1e66d59f532d92f5d6e4000f14a004c004dec745cc2be108d11cc4eed1
confirmations
361653
spent
true